Common Causes of Hair Loss in Women
For some women, the hair comes out in clumps after a big stress. Others notice a slow, steady widening of their part up top. The root cause makes all the difference-it decides if a basic supplement fixes things or you need a full medical check.
Androgenetic Alopecia (Female Pattern Hair Loss)
This is the most common reason for gradual thinning. It runs in families-if your mom or sisters have the same issue, your chances go up. Androgens-especially dihydrotestosterone, or DHT-shrink hair follicles on the top of the scalp. The result? A wider part and thinner crown, but you rarely see a receding hairline. Roughly one in three women over 40 shows signs of this pattern.
Telogen Effluvium
This is the sudden, widespread shedding that appears three to six months after a physical or emotional shock. Think major surgery (a rough flu)fast weight loss, or extreme stress. The good news? It's nearly always temporary. Once the trigger is gone, regrowth begins in a matter of months.
Nutritional Deficiencies
Low iron is the sneaky culprit here. Ferritin below 30-40 ng/mL, that's a level often linked to thinning women can't explain. Vitamin D deficiency is another common culprit, studies link low levels to non-scarring alopecia.
Zinc and B12 also matter.
Hormonal Imbalances
Thyroid disorders, both hyper- and hypothyroidism, trigger hair loss, and it's diffuse, often paired with shifts in energy or weight. Polycystic ovary syndrome (PCOS) raises androgen levels, mimicking male-pattern thinning. Menopause brings its own drop in oestrogen, which leaves hair finer and slower-growing. Getting hormones checked, TSH, free T4, sex hormones, can point straight to the cause.
Other Common Causes
- Alopecia areata , an autoimmune attack that leaves round, smooth patches. It can come and go unpredictably.
- Traction alopecia (from tight ponytails)weaves, or braids over years. Early changes are reversible if the pulling stops.
- Medications (certain blood pressure drugs)antidepressants, and chemotherapy agents list hair loss as a side effect.
Sorting through these causes starts with a careful history and a few targeted tests. The most common female hair loss causes (genetics)hormones, stress, and nutrition, each respond to different remedies, which is why guessing rarely works.
Understanding Female Pattern Hair Loss (Androgenetic Alopecia)
Distaff practice hair loss, or androgenetic alopecia, is the most common driver behind thinning hair in women, yet many still assume it's something that only happens to men. Hair follicles with a genetic predisposition become sensitive to dihydrotestosterone (DHT), a derivative of testosterone. Over time, they slowly shrink. The result? Shorter growth cycles and finer strands, eventually, less coverage across the top.
This pattern is distinct from male balding, and in women, the hairline usually stays intact. But the crown and mid-scalp gradually become more see-through. Dermatologists grade it using the Ludwig scale, from mild (I) to advanced (III). And it often accelerates around menopause, when oestrogen levels drop and androgen activity takes a bigger stage
Diagnosis starts by ruling out other female hair loss causes like telogen effluvium, thyroid dysfunction, or iron deficiency. A simple blood panel plus a gentle pull test in the clinic usually tells the story. And here's the thing: pattern loss responds best to early treatment. Once a follicle is fully miniaturised, it's gone for good.
What works? Oral anti‑androgens such as spironolactone are prescribed off‑label to block DHT's effect. Finasteride may help in postmenopausal women. Low‑level laser therapy and PRP injections have supporting data too, though results vary.
For women with advanced thinning and adequate donor hair, a hair transplant can restore density, but only if the underlying hormonal trigger is managed first. That combination matters more than any single remedy
Diagnosis: How Doctors Determine the Cause
Getting to the root of female hair loss causes isn't something you can just guess at. Diagnosis usually starts with a detailed conversation. Your doctor or trichologist will ask about your medical history, recent stressors, medications, and any changes in your menstrual cycle. The timing matters: they'll ask when the shedding started and whether it came on suddenly or crept up over months.
From there, a blood test is standard. Blood work includes ferritin levels (iron storage) (vitamin D)thyroid function (TSH, T3, T4), and sex hormones including testosterone, DHEA-S, and SHBG. A full blood count rules out anaemia. Zinc deficiency? Also common in women with thinning hair. About one in three premenopausal women with hair loss shows low ferritin below 30 ng/mL, yet many labs still flag normal above 15, too low for healthy growth.
Next, a scalp examination follows. Dermoscopy, a handheld magnifier with light, lets the doctor see miniaturized hairs (tell-tale for androgenetic alopecia), broken hairs (telogen effluvium), or patchy scaling (lichen planopilaris). They might do a gentle pull test: grasping 20-50 hairs and tugging. If more than two or three come out, active shedding is happening.
In some cases (especially when the pattern doesn't fit the usual picture)a scalp biopsy tells you what's really going on. The 4-mm punch sample goes under the microscope to tell permanent scarring alopecia apart from reversible forms. Recovery is quick. You walk out with one stitch.
Honestly, the process is straightforward. Clear diagnosis means you stop chasing random products and start targeting the real cause-whether that's a hormone shift, a nutritional gap, or telogen effluvium from a tough flu six months ago.
Treatment Options: From Lifestyle Changes to Hair Transplant
Not all hair loss needs the same fix. A woman shedding from a three-month stress spike gets a totally different plan from someone with a steady crown thinning over five years. The cause , not the symptom is matched by Treatment.
First mover: lifestyle. Iron supplementation (if your blood work backs it up), vitamin D up to 2000 IU daily, and zinc around 15 mg can stop excessive shedding within three months. Don't guess. Ask your GP for a full iron panel, not just haemoglobin.
Then there's the stress piece. Telogen effluvium spikes after illness, surgery, or emotional strain by about 8-12 weeks. If that's your pattern, sleep hygiene, a solid 30g protein at breakfast, and maybe a low-dose ashwagandha trial can pull the cycle back to normal. Hair usually regrows on its own - it just needs time and decent fuel.
If hair keeps thinning despite good blood work and a calmer life, androgenetic alopecia is the likely driver. But it's not a quick fix, and miss three days and the shed starts creeping back. Expect initial shedding around weeks 2-6 - that means it's working.
Anti-androgen options like spironolactone (25-100 mg daily) are used off-label in women with high DHT sensitivity. Works better if you're not planning pregnancy soon. And oral minoxidil - a recent favourite in clinics - runs about 1-2 mg daily with decent frontal regrowth rates, though you'll need monthly blood pressure checks.
PRP (platelet-rich plasma) lands somewhere in the middle, and three sessions, one month apart, then top-ups every 4-6 months. Laser helmets (low-level light therapy) show similar modest results in trials, mostly for crown thinning.
And transplant? It has a specific place. Women with stable male-pattern thinning and a healthy donor zone (back of the head) can be good candidates - but not if the loss is diffuse, since you need strong hair at the back to move forward. A consultation should include a dermoscopy exam and at least 12 months of medical therapy first.
The key is patience and proper diagnosis - the wrong fix just wastes time
When to Worry About Hair Loss and How to Talk to Your Doctor
Most women lose 50 to 100 strands a day - that's normal. Worry starts when the numbers climb or the pattern shifts. If you're pulling clumps out in the shower, finding hair on your pillow in the morning, or noticing a part that keeps widening over a few weeks, it's time to pay attention. Sudden loss after a major life event (childbirth, surgery, high fever) often signals telogen effluvium, which typically resolves on its own within six months. Gradual thinning at the crown or along the front of the scalp points toward androgenetic alopecia, a genetic condition that responds best to early treatment. Patchy bald spots that appear overnight may be alopecia areata. Any of these scenarios warrants a conversation with a professional.
Before you see your GP or a trichologist, gather a few specifics. Start a hair diary: note when the shedding began, any recent stress or illness, changes in diet, and a list of every pill, supplement, or topical product you use. Take clear photos of your scalp in good light - one from the front, one from the top, one from behind. This gives your doctor a visual timeline. Ask for a blood panel-ferritin (iron stores), vitamin D, thyroid (TSH, T3, T4), and sex hormones (testosterone, DHEA-S, SHBG). Iron deficiency alone drives a lot of female hair loss-fix it and the shedding often reverses. Be sure to mention if you've changed birth control, started or stopped HRT, or had a baby in the past year.
When you sit down with your clinician, be direct. Tell them you've been losing hair for X weeks and you want to find out why. See if a scalp biopsy or pull test would be useful.
